Introduction

M&SOM - Manufacturing & Service Operations Management, published by INFORMS, is a leading journal dedicated to advancing the field of operations management since its inception in 1999. With an impact factor that reflects its reputation as a top-tier publication, M&SOM is categorically ranked in Q1 for both Management Science and Operations Research, as well as Strategy and Management, positioning it among the elite journals in its domain. Practitioners and scholars alike benefit from insightful research that addresses critical challenges in manufacturing and service operations across diverse industries. The journal's commitment to fostering innovation is evident through its rigorous peer-review process, ensuring the publication of high-quality articles that contribute significantly to theory and practice. Researchers, professionals, and students engaged in operations management will find M&SOM a vital resource for the latest trends, methodologies, and strategic insights.
